Cloud121 | Jun 30, 2004 | |||
Which console is Sega's best? Between the MegaDrive and Super Famicom, I have to go with the MegaDrive. I love the MD's poor sound quality. The scratchy voices, the weird sound effects in place of the SFC version's (somewhat) digitized sound. Not too mention, I love the limited color palette. It's kinda fun seeing games with crisp, clean, colorful visuals on SFC, then play the MD version and see it be a little darker, along with somewhat odd looking visuals, due to the limited color palette. Then again, the MD didn't set world records for slow down, like the SFC did. If only Nintendo went with 5 MHZ, as opposed to 3.58 MHZ... Besides, without the MD, I can't play my beloved 32x! :bow From an RPG standpoint. I'd say they're equal. Phantasy Star IV is the greatest RPG ever, and Final Fantasy IV is the best RPG Square has ever made (it just BARELY edges out Chrono Cross and Parasite Eve as my favorite Square game). The MD has PS and the Shining games (if you count the Mega CD, you got Lunar, Vay, and Popful Mail as well) The SFC has FF, BoF, Seiken Densetsu, CT, and Mario RPG (My first RPG! Actually, scratch the equal part. I think the MD has the advantage. The sheer greatness that is PSIV, and the addicting as hell Shining Force games (never played Shining in The Darkness), make it the winner in my book. :thumbs-up: |
